RECYCLED CRACKERS

Use cardboard tubes or loo rolls and brown paper to make crackers. Ours are silent but you can add a cracker snap if you wish. First cut a 27cm x 17cm piece of brown paper. Take 2 tubes or loo rolls, and cut 1 in half. Fill the whole tube with a gift (toys, sweets or even jewellery), then line up the tubes along one edge of the paper, with the whole tube in the middle and the half tubes at each end, and glue in place. Roll up in the paper, then scrunch and tie the ends with ribbon.

BAGS OF FUN

Turn paper bags into cute gift bags – simply cut out eyes, ears, beaks and antlers in coloured paper and stick them on the bags to make woodland creatures. Materials from mrprice.ie.

JOYFUL JARS

Wrap your present in brown paper. Draw a jam jar on the front. Stick on a sprig of berries ‘in’ the jar with double-sided tape. Wrap the parcel with ribbon, tying in a bow over the sprig.

SEASONAL STREET

Create our house gift wrap by drawing doors and windows on brown paper-wrapped parcels. Bend green pipe cleaners into wreaths, glue red bows on and attach to the doors with doubleside­d tape, and draw trees decorated with cranberrie­s. Materials from artnhobby.ie and mrprice.ie.
